There were times many times over the last five years of playing online PLO, that i felt unbeatable. I never played nosebleeds, apart from the odd tilt shot, and was happy getting the lot at $50/$100. I used to win maybe 7/10 days, and i once remember a streak of 28 winning days. The easy days seem over for the time being.
There are many problems with the games at the moment. Online HU PLO has become full of "game selectors", basically nits that sit around all day waiting for one or two super fish. They don't even play the bad regulars....
The games are dry on the Euro sites, and most of the players on Full Tilt who will play me HU $50/$100 or higher are at least competent. I don't have the patience to sit around for 8 hours waiting for a fish to arrive.... so often end up playing big winners.

I've reached some conclusions about online PLO at the moment. The players who were bad a while ago (2/3 years ago), are now average/good. The good players are now very good, the very good players are excellent etc. 10/20 - 25/50 is still pretty easy to beat, but i don't have the motivation to play those stakes anymore. 50/100 100/200 is very tough now. I rarely get to play players i think i have a massive edge on, most of the time i'm battling with top top players. To beat these players you need to have insane discipline, always play your best, never tilt, have a stringent stop loss, not play drunk etc
The last six months i've had bad discipline, tilted very easy, no stop loss, often played my C game, tried to win too quickly because i can't be bothered in having long sessions. I'm lucky that i've managed to win over the last six months really. I've had like 6-8 £100k+ losing days, which at the stakes i play is very hard to get back.

Ych i remember when (midnight UK time), i could just fire up my accounts on various sites and be playing 2/3 games within a few minutes. It seems 50/100 100/200 PLO, has less and less players, and even those who are about are just nits who sit around for a few people, who they deem super fishy.
The one thing i have never done in poker is permanently quit a player who wants to play me Heads Up. I guess that’s why it’s so tilting to sometimes see 4/5 people that i’d happily play, and they just sit out and say No Thanks... right now there is one person sitting on Betfair at 50 100 (who doesn’t play anyone) and not one person on Full Tilt. I can’t even be bothered to sit down, as i often have to wait hours for a game.
Surely anonymous tables, where you can just choose a name before you sit down could create action for regulars.
